We have made it to the beginning of week 3 and so far, so good! We are starting to see students with allergy symptoms which is to be expected as the season is starting to change. Because allergy symptoms are so similar to COVID-19 symptoms, please make sure that your child's allergies are being treated so that this doesn't affect their ability to stay in school. We want to keep our kids here!
Please continue to do your daily wellness screenings at home. We must continue this practice to help keep our students in school and learning, so let's work together to make that happen!
If your child has any of the following symptoms, please keep them home (if you have any questions about symptoms, feel free to call me at 417-637-5921 ext. 1212 and I will assist you in making the decision whether they should stay home or not).
• Fever or chills
• Cough
• Muscle aches
• Nausea, vomiting or diarrhea
• New loss of taste or smell
• New runny nose or congestion
• Shortness of breath or difficulty breathing
• Sore throat
• Close contact with a person with COVID-19 in the last 14 days
Also, please don't forget to send your child with a water bottle. Thank you so much for your help keeping our students healthy and learning!
